service for access by restful clients.
Second,Enhanced integration of ESB with SaaS cloud applications. With the overwhelming popularity of cloud computing, people have become increasingly clear about the cloud, more and more recognized for the cloud computing economy, and cloud applications have become increasingly popular. As SaaS applications become increasingly popular, enterprises cannot deploy all th
is designed to achieve domain-specific business goals. The ESB implements the connection or integration logic in the solution. This logic performs service virtualization and aspect-oriented connectivity, designed to achieve on-demand interconnection between application services.
In an ideal service-oriented solution, the separation between application and business logic and connectivity and integration logic is "thorough", meaning that service reques
applications: ESB can implement protocol conversion for existing applications through some technical components, so that existing applications can be quickly integrated into the environment of enterprise integration, it will not form an isolated information islands.
Traffic control: ensures high availability of high-priority services.
Intra-Domain Application System
An intra-domain application system is the actual provider and consumer of int
report of the forister Institute, ESB can improve connectivity, increase flexibility to promote development, and enhance control over important resources, so as to help enterprises realize the value of SOA.An ESB can be used not only to process integration projects that previously relied on EAI tools, but also to establish B2B relationships between enterprises.E
Bus (ESB) is developed from Service-Oriented Architecture (SOA. SOA describes an IT infrastructure application integration model. The soft component set is a hierarchical structure with clear definitions, an ESB is a pre-assembled SOA implementation that includes the basic functional components necessary to achieve the SOA layered goal.
ESB is a product of the c
(Next: Architecture Design: Inter-system Communication (34)-The deified ESB (UP))2-4. ESB and version controlThe process of system integration in enterprises, there are many non-technical factors caused by the change. It is possible that a call function A, which has been able to function normally, is suddenly not available on one day. The technical team and the b
.
Evolution in service Management
From EAI to ESB is actually an optimization of the business management approach, but as mentioned above, not all enterprises are suitable for using ESB technology based on SOA architecture ideas. At present, the integration of the internal business systems of most enterprises
The theme is: It takes five years to activate the full potential of SOA. However, there is a simple assertion in the interview that using the Enterprise service Bus (Enterprise service bus,esb) is the third step in 4 steps to achieve the full potential of the ESB. The steps in the Don Rippert model are as follows:
Use XML to use the application interface in a more standard way.
Capture some business proce
We started our discussion on the basis of Wikipedia (ESB).
It seems that one of the common understandings is that an ESB is a separate category of products that are distinct from the preparation (orchestration) and business process management (Business processes Management). In addition, there is a lot of controversy about whether the ESB is a product or a model
1.OverviewWeb Services are a common solution for ESB middleware, which enables different applications running on different machines to exchange data or integrations without the help of additional, specialized third-party software or hardware. applications that are implemented according to the WEB Service specification can exchange data with each other, regardless of the language, platform, or internal protocol they are using. Aeaiesb provides a very
=============================="Architecture Design: Inter-system Communication (42)--DIY ESB (3)"5. Borker Server SelectionIn the previous three articles, we introduced the design of the top-level design of ESB middleware, introduced the main control service how to log collection and monitoring of multiple esb-brokers dynamic nodes, and also introduced the
Absrtact: This paper introduces the interaction and coupling problems in the process of informatization construction of modern enterprises, expounds the solution of service-oriented enterprise application--ESB Enterprise Service Bus, gives the detailed design of this solution, and presents the implementation example.
Keywords: service oriented; enterprise solution; Enterprise Service Bus
Middle Figure categ
in the enterprise, the most valuable services, applications to such services should be very frequent, so the need for ESB support at the same time the business can be very onerous. Therefore, the ESB product is designed to implement a stateless, high-throughput service bus that provides transparent, standard, open access to critical business services within the enterprise. It is not a good deal to transfer
enterprises. software from c/s to B/S must be integrated in a data center and accessible in a network portal, A dedicated analysis room also uses data center data for business intelligence analysis.
Of course, WebService, XML, message-oriented middleware, bepl, and ESB are indispensable.
In the past, the integration of Lan C/S management software systems was usually through mutual reading of their database
Thinking:What is the definition of 1.ESB? Is it a product or an architectural model?What is the practical use of 2.ESB?Defining an ESBFor enterprise Service Bus, there is currently no accepted definition, depending on the vendor and source, there are a number of different definitions, including the following definitions:An integrated architecture style that enables communication between providers and servic
permissions is also optional. Accounts, permissions, and audit information are stored in an embedded hypersonic database.
Figure 7 Resource-oriented service securitySummary
Unlike runtime service management solutions such as actional or managedmethods, the middleware used to implement ESB is a required condition for any SOA success. Without an ESB, organizations can add P2P interactions simply by using We
Author
Adrien Louis Translator
Hu Jian Summary
When implementing SOA, infrastructure such as the Enterprise Service Bus (ESB) is very popular. In an enterprise, there are at least two different implementation ideas for this infrastructure: using multiple ESB servers in the company, each server solves special integration problems for a specific department; or use an E
Introduction to Enterprise Application Integration and Open-Source ESB products ServiceMix and mule
Agenda
• Internal requirements of enterprises for Application Integration• Problems faced by enterprise IT facilities• Architecture solution for Enterprise Application Integration• Roles and Responsibilities of ESB• ServiceMix Introduction-ServiceMix Architecture-S
1. OverviewWhen I started thinking about this article on "DIY ESB middleware", I had several attempts to give up. This is not because of the inertia of lengthy articles, but rather the technical knowledge involved in the ESB and the design difficulties that need to be overcome, and the lengthy few posts cannot even summarize them all, and if the idea is a little bit wrong it will mislead the reader. an
application framework, such as the spring container or the workflow system. it provides a framework and simple method for calling SOA services in enterprises.
What are the limitations between ESB and actual enterprise applications?
Currently, ESB has many commercial solutions and many open-source products, such as objectweb, codehaus, and SourceForge. there is
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.